How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 30102?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 30102 Studio Apartments | $1,532 | $925 | $3,198 |
| 30102 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,808 | $975 | $4,564 |
| 30102 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,156 | $1,199 | $7,178 |
| 30102 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,630 | $1,550 | $5,803 |
| 30102 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,229 | $3,213 | $3,263 |
